プログラミング教育で子供の創造性を伸ばす!教材開発と教師研修の重要性
- 教育現場にプログラミング教育を取り入れることで、論理的思考力や創造力を育むことができます。
- プログラミング教育用の教材開発には、子供の発達段階に合わせた適切な難易度設定が重要です。
- 教師向けの研修プログラムを用意し、プログラミング教育の指導力を高めることが不可欠です。
子供の創造性を伸ばすプログラミング教育の重要性とは?
近年、プログラミング教育の重要性が指摘されています。なぜプログラミング教育が求められているのでしょうか?子供たちの創造性を伸ばすためには、プログラミングの学習が不可欠な理由をご説明します。
プログラミングを通して「創造力」と「論理的思考力」を育む
プログラミングを学ぶことで、子供たちは創造力と論理的思考力を身につけることができます。プログラミングとは、コンピューターに対して命令を出すための言語を使って作業を行うことです。この過程で、子供たちは自分の考えを整理し、論理的に表現する力を養うことができます。また、与えられた課題に対して創造的なアプローチを見つけることで、創造力も育まれます。
事例紹介: 小学校でのプログラミング教育の実践
某小学校では、プログラミング教育を通して子供たちの問題解決能力の向上を目指しています。授業では、ゲームの作成などを通じてプログラミングを学びます。子供たちは試行錯誤を重ねながら、創造的な発想と論理的な思考を働かせて課題に取り組んでいます。
教師からは「子供たちが主体的に考え、新しいアイデアを生み出す姿が見られるようになった」との声が聞かれています。
プログラミング教育が求められる背景
プログラミング教育の必要性が高まっている背景には、AIやIoTなどの技術革新による社会の変化があります。これらの技術は私たちの生活に深く浸透しており、子供たちにとってプログラミングの基礎知識は欠かせない能力となっています。また、プログラミングを学ぶことで培われる論理的思考力は、あらゆる分野で役立つ汎用的な能力です。
プログラミング教育用教材開発の現状と課題
プログラミング教育を実施するためには、適切な教材の開発が不可欠です。しかし、現状では発達段階に合わせた教材が不足しているなどの課題があります。教材開発における現状と課題、そして解決策について解説します。
発達段階に合った教材の重要性
子供の発達段階に合わせて、適切な難易度の教材を用意することが重要です。プログラミングの概念は抽象的であり、年齢が低い子供ほど理解が難しくなります。発達段階に合わない教材を使うと、子供の興味関心を失わせてしまう恐れがあります。
注目データ: 小学生のプログラミング学習状況
・小学校の約50%でプログラミング教育が実施されている(文部科学省調べ、2022年)
・プログラミング教育を受けた小学生の約30%が「難しかった」と回答(民間調査、2021年)
・プログラミング教育に関する教師の研修機会が不足している実態がある(文部科学省調べ、2022年)
教材開発における課題と解決策
発達段階に合わせた教材開発には、以下のような課題があります。
- 子供の理解度を適切に評価する指標が不明確
- 教師のプログラミング指導力不足による適切な教材選定の難しさ
- 教材開発のための予算や人員が不足している
実践のヒント: 発達段階に合った教材開発のポイント
- 子供の認知発達段階を考慮した教材構成
- ゲーム感覚で楽しめる教材の工夫
- 視覚的な教材の活用(アニメーションやイラストなど)
- 段階的な難易度設定と、達成感が得られる工夫
- 教師向けの指導ガイドラインの作成
教師のプログラミング指導力向上に向けて
プログラミング教育を円滑に実施するためには、教師のプログラミング指導力の向上が欠かせません。現状の課題と、効果的な教師研修プログラムの在り方について解説します。
教師研修の現状と課題
教師のプログラミング指導力を高めるための研修プログラムは、まだ十分に整備されていない状況にあります。主な課題は以下の通りです。
- 研修プログラムの質や内容にばらつきがある
- 教師の負担増を懸念し、研修機会を設けにくい
- プログラミング指導に関する具体的なノウハウが不足している
効果的な教師研修プログラムのポイント
教師のプログラミング指導力を効果的に高めるためには、以下のようなポイントが重要です。
重要なポイント
- 実践的な指導ノウハウの習得
- 発達段階に応じた指導法の理解
- 教材の活用方法や評価方法の習得
- 継続的な研修の機会の確保
- 教師同士の情報共有やコミュニティ形成の促進
教師一人ひとりのプログラミング指導力を高めることで、子供たちに質の高い教育を提供することができます。学校と教育委員会、さらには民間企業などが連携し、効果的な研修プログラムの開発と実施に取り組む必要があります。